[b]75% of all the legendaries are gated behind pvp rep / crucible marks[/b]
[b]Almost all of the exotic bounties have difficult pvp steps[/b]
[i]Thorn – Exotic Handgun -- Kill Guardians in the Crucible using void damage. Deaths slow your progress greatly!
Bad Juju – Exotic Pulse Rifle -- Fight in the Crucible and obtain 10,000 points and have a kill to death ratio above 1-1
Invective – Shotgun -- Fight in the Crucible and achieve 25 more kills than deaths.
Fate of All Fools – Exotic Scout Rifle -- Multiple PvP steps[/i]
[b]Every special event that has occurred is occurring or is scheduled to occur is pvp oriented[/b]
[i]Salvage - PvP
Combined Arms - PvP
Queen's Wrath - PvP/PvE
Iron Banner - PvP[/i]
I thought Queen's bounty was going to be a pure pve event, but alas 3 out of the 4 bounties for today are, you guessed it, pvp bounties.
Why the extreme bias in favor of pvp when this game was touted as a shared world, rpg style loot, exploration heavy, "play your way" kind of game?
If you're going to have all these pvp events and do nothing for the pvers you're cutting yourselves off at the knees, and the description of the game offered by Bungie feels misleading.
[b]Possible solutions:[/b]
Give bounties dual objectives, 1 that's pvp centric and 1 that's pve centric and allow the player to choose which way to finish the bounties.
Open up all of the vendors to both currencies.
I understand that recycling PvP which kind of creates its own content is easier than creating something new for PvE, but I'd be happy even with a recycled content PvE event mixed in with all of the PvP events. Queen event is the best attempt at that thus far, but all of the other events are purely focused on PvP and it just feels as though the PvE is being jilted.

2 RepliesEdited by MASSive: 9/25/2014 6:28:37 PM[quote][b]75% of all the legendaries are gated behind pvp rep / crucible marks[/b][/quote] False. Stop being over dramatic. There are a total of 24 legendary weapons that require playing PvP to purchase from Crucible-based vendors (this includes factions). There are also 12 legendary weapons that require only PvE play to buy. This does not count the special event weapons which do not require PvP play. Also, there are legendary drops, the Vault of Glass weapons, the PS exclusive weapons, etc. Not to mention that you are able to get the "PvP exclusive" weapons from decryption or random drop. While you may have a little room to complain about exotic weapons, you do not for the legendary.

11 RepliesI think its primarily because all new PvE content takes a great deal of time and effort to create refine and polish to the point where it's ready for public play. More than a couple of weeks after launch to be certain! I have actually received many of what you called "gated" Legendary weapons and armor pieces through PvE content. 1: Cryptic Dragon Scout Rifle [Crucible via Lord Shax], obtained from Legendary Engram decryption while playing story on Venus at Campus 9. 2: Unwilling Soul Auto Rifle [Dead Orbit] obtained as a reward for completing the Week 1 Devil's Lair Nightfall. 3: Hex Caster Arc Auto Rifle [Dead Orbit] obtained Via Legendary Engram decryption, received while patrolling Mars' Buried City. 4: The Cure Rocket Launcher [FWC] obtained from Week 3 Nexus Nightfall. 5: The Chance Hand Cannon: [FWC] obtained from week 2 Summoning Pits Nightfall (from which my friend and fireteam member obtained the incredible Suros Regime!) I have actually received several legendary vanguard weapons as a result of mission rewards and legendary/rare decryptions as well, notably the Light/Beware fusion rifle, but those aren't "gated behind PvP" as you say, so I suppose they don't count. Additionally, there are always Xur's exotics which can be obtained via the strange coins gathered in ALL modes of play. As for the Queen's Bounties, yesterday 3/5 were PvE based, not to mention that every SINGLE queen's wrath mission is a PvE Story event... but I suppose you prefer to ignore the points that work against your general complaint, so we'll move on. As far as Legendary faction armor goes, it can also be obtained through PvE in the same ways as my examples above show, I received the Justicar's Hood [New Monarchy] in just this fashion. If you want to BUY these legendaries, you need crucible marks to obtain them. This is true, but you can still get them regardless of your affinity for type of play. As it happens, the versions obtained outside of vendors don't usually have the same stock bonus sets as those bought, and their stats are typically slightly better overall. So...in the end, the game isn't extremely biased in favor of PvP, but rather the game tries to give players a REASON to play PvP, whether it's working on your faction reputation to get access to that weapon that suits your PvP play style, or for the armor set that suits your preferred pair of ability stats. Note, buying one of those Legendary weapons requires 150 marks, a full week and a half of Crucible investments! With minimum value armor piece prices at 65 marks, you can only buy ~1.66 legendary armor items in any given week, provided that you completely forgo ALL legendary weapons and give up on the more expensive 120 mark armor pieces. Working toward buying your legendary items is much tougher than finding them in the wild, and this makes PvE likely the best mode of play for obtaining high quality items, at least that's how I got myself geared to the point where my friend and I two-manned the Nexus Nightfall in under half an hour.
